Level 14 : Blinds 2,000/4,000, 4,000 ante

With late registration now closed, tournament officials have announced the official prize pool for the Main Event.

There were a total of 757 entries, generating a prize pool of $2,089,320. The top 89 players will finish in the money, with the winner earning $372,800.

Netaliev Eliminated

Level 14 : Blinds 2,000/4,000, 4,000 ante
Oleg Netaliev
Oleg Netaliev

Oleg Netaliev raised to 10,000 from the button. Makram Bou Habib three-bet to 38,000 from the small blind. Netaliev thren four-bet jammed all in and Bou Habib called.

Oleg Netaliev: {10-Diamonds}{10-Hearts}
Makram Bou Habib: {a-Diamonds}{k-Spades}

The flop put Netaliev in deep trouble as it came {k-Diamonds}{3-Hearts}{a-Clubs}. The turn was the {9-Spades} and the river the {5-Clubs} to end the tournament for Netaliev.

Lampropulos Survives a Race With Martinsek

Level 14 : Blinds 2,000/4,000, 4,000 ante

Jan Martinsek had a raise to 18,000 in front of him from the small blind before Nikos Lampropulos moved all in for his last 108,000 in the cutoff. Martinsek tanked for a moment before he called.

Nikos Lampropulos: {7-Diamonds}{7-Clubs}
Jan Martinsek: {k-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ds}

"What," tablemate Nina Krasilnikova said after seeing the hand Martinsek called with. Lampropulos had to win the race to survive and took a big lead when the {a-Hearts}{3-Hearts}{7-Hearts} flop gave him a set.

The turn came the {9-Hearts} and Martinsek was already drawing dead as the {5-Clubs} fell on the river.

Er Spikes the River on M'hiri

Level 14 : Blinds 2,000/4,000, 4,000 ante

Zorlu Er and Chakib M'hiri saw the turn on a board of {k-Hearts}{10-Diamonds}{4-Clubs}{10-Hearts}. M'hiri bet 25,000 and Er moved all in for 85,000.

M'hiri quickly tossed in a chip to call. "Do you have a ten," Er said, standing up from his seat.

"Of course," M'hiri replied, showing {10-Spades}{9-Diamonds}.

Er threw his arms in the air in frustration as he opened up {a-Spades}{k-Diamonds} and prepared to make his exit. The river, though, came the {k-Clubs} and Er made a full house to remain in the tournament.

Sultanem Holds On With Aces

Level 14 : Blinds 2,000/4,000, 4,000 ante

Georges Sultanem was all in for 185,000 on a flop of {7-Spades}{3-Hearts}{6-Hearts} and up against Salavat Shafigullin.

Georges Sultanem: {a-Clubs}{a-Hearts}
Salavat Shafigullin: {j-Hearts}{7-Hearts}

Sultanem had aces, but Shafigullin had top pair and a flush draw. The {k-Diamonds} on the turn was no help, while the {5-Diamonds} river was safe for Sultanem as he held on to double up.

Smuskevicius Plays Back at the Chip Leader, Shows He Had It

Level 14 : Blinds 2,000/4,000, 4,000 ante

Boris Smuskevicius and Kubanychbek Abakirov built a pot of around 80,000 by the turn on a board of {5-Spades}{3-Hearts}{3-Clubs}{6-Hearts}. Abakirov, in the hijack, bet 50,000.

Smuskevicius then raised to 125,000 in middle position and Abakirov tanked for about a minute before he slid his cards into the middle. Smuskevicius showed {6-Diamonds}{6-Spades} for the turned full house as he took a small bite out of Abakirov's massive stack.
